Career Overview

Machine Learning Engineers design, build, and deploy systems that can learn patterns from data and make predictions or decisions with minimal human intervention. They bridge the gap between data science research and production software, taking prototype models and turning them into scalable, reliable systems that operate in real-world applications. Their work involves data pipeline construction, model training and evaluation, and continuous monitoring of deployed systems to ensure accuracy and performance over time.

Education Paths

  • Required minimum: Bachelor's in Computer Science, Math, or related field — Strong foundation in programming, statistics, linear algebra, and algorithms is essential.
  • Most common: Master's in Computer Science, Data Science, or AI — Most competitive candidates hold a graduate degree with coursework or research in machine learning and deep learning.
  • Accelerator: ML/AI Certifications (e.g., TensorFlow Developer, AWS ML Specialty) — Practical certifications and portfolio projects on platforms like Kaggle can strengthen job prospects and demonstrate applied skills.

AI Impact on This Career

Machine Learning Engineers are largely insulated from AI displacement because they are the ones building, deploying, and maintaining the very systems driving automation elsewhere. Demand continues to rise as companies race to integrate AI into products, though the role is shifting toward more MLOps, system design, and applied engineering rather than manual model tuning. AI coding assistants speed up development but require skilled engineers to guide architecture, debug, and validate outcomes.

Automation exposure: Routine coding tasks, boilerplate model setup, hyperparameter tuning, and basic data preprocessing are increasingly automated by AI copilots and AutoML tools.

The human edge: Deep understanding of business problems, system architecture design, ethical judgment, cross-team collaboration, and the ability to troubleshoot complex, novel failures in production systems.
